<title>scsi: target: iscsi: Use hex2bin instead of a re-implementation</title>

This change has the following effects, in order of descreasing importance:

1) Prevent a stack buffer overflow

2) Do not append an unnecessary NULL to an anyway binary buffer, which
   is writing one byte past client_digest when caller is:
   chap_string_to_hex(client_digest, chap_r, strlen(chap_r));

The latter was found by KASAN (see below) when input value hes expected size
(32 hex chars), and further analysis revealed a stack buffer overflow can
happen when network-received value is longer, allowing an unauthenticated
remote attacker to smash up to 17 bytes after destination buffer (16 bytes
attacker-controlled and one null).  As switching to hex2bin requires
specifying destination buffer length, and does not internally append any null,
it solves both issues.

This addresses CVE-2018-14633.

Beyond this:

- Validate received value length and check hex2bin accepted the input, to log
  this rejection reason instead of just failing authentication.

- Only log received CHAP_R and CHAP_C values once they passed sanity checks.

<title>scsi: iscsi: target: Fix conn_ops double free</title>

If iscsi_login_init_conn fails it can free conn_ops.
__iscsi_target_login_thread will then call iscsi_target_login_sess_out
which will also free it.

This fixes the problem by organizing conn allocation/setup into parts that
are needed through the life of the conn and parts that are only needed for
the login. The free functions then release what was allocated in the alloc
functions.

With this patch we have:

iscsit_alloc_conn/iscsit_free_conn - allocs/frees the conn we need for the
entire life of the conn.

iscsi_login_init_conn/iscsi_target_nego_release - allocs/frees the parts
of the conn that are only needed during login.

<title>iscsi target: fix session creation failure handling</title>

The problem is that iscsi_login_zero_tsih_s1 sets conn-&gt;sess early in
iscsi_login_set_conn_values. If the function fails later like when we
alloc the idr it does kfree(sess) and leaves the conn-&gt;sess pointer set.
iscsi_login_zero_tsih_s1 then returns -Exyz and we then call
iscsi_target_login_sess_out and access the freed memory.

This patch has iscsi_login_zero_tsih_s1 either completely setup the
session or completely tear it down, so later in
iscsi_target_login_sess_out we can just check for it being set to the
connection.
